dim_STAT User’s Guide
July 8th, 2008 · No Comments
dim_STAT is a tool for general/detailed performance analyze and monitoring of Solaris and Linux systems.
Main features are:
♦ Web based interface
♦ All collected data saved in SQL database
♦ Several proposed data views
♦ Interactive (Java) or static (PNG) graphs
♦ Real Time Monitoring
♦ Multi-Host monitoring
♦ Post analyzing
♦ New Statistics integration (Add-On)
♦ Professional Reporting with automated features
♦ One-Click STAT-Bookmarks
